Pricing

At Terra Pointe Memory Care, the monthly costs reflect a commitment to quality care tailored specifically for individuals with memory challenges. The semi-private room is priced at $3,300 per month, which is notably higher than the average rates in Maricopa County at $2,801 and across Arizona at $2,820. For those seeking a more private living experience, the studio option is available for $4,300 per month - again above both the county average of $3,960 and the state average of $3,829. These rates not only indicate Terra Pointe's premium offerings in terms of personalized care and specialized services but also underscore its dedication to fostering a supportive environment for residents and their families.

Review

Terra Pointe Memory Care has garnered a diverse array of reviews from family members who have placed their loved ones in this facility, reflecting a spectrum of experiences and satisfaction levels. While many reviewers express gratitude for the care provided at Terra Pointe, others raise significant concerns about the quality of service and general environment for residents. Overall, it emerges as a place where personal experiences greatly influence perceptions, leading to contrasting views on its effectiveness as a memory care residence.

Several families share positive anecdotes that highlight the dedication and compassion of the staff. One reviewer emphasizes the friendly and caring nature of those working at Terra Pointe, noting how they seem genuinely invested in the well-being of residents. This sentiment is echoed by another family member who praised the cleanliness of the facility and commended the chef for preparing meals from scratch. They felt reassured knowing their loved one was cared for by dedicated individuals committed to improving their quality of life through activities and social engagement. Tales of personalized interactions between staff and residents further illustrate an inviting atmosphere filled with laughter, music, and community.

Conversely, not all feedback is as favorable. A recurring theme among critical reviews revolves around high staff turnover rates, which many believe result from inadequate pay or support for caregivers. This rapid turnover appears to lead to inconsistencies in care quality; some families report instances where calls for assistance go unanswered or where residents are left without supervision during critical moments. One reviewer expressed distress over their loved one's unkempt condition when visiting, criticizing both hygiene protocols as well as staff attitudes toward family members seeking assistance.

The dining experience at Terra Pointe also draws mixed reactions. While some reviewers praise the food quality and variety available to residents – highlighting how enjoyable it seems to them – others note that menu repetition can become tiresome over time. In addition to concerns about meal options, certain individuals report poor communication around activities available for their loved ones in memory care settings. The commitment to engaging patients appears inconsistent according to some reviews; instances were noted when relatives felt their loved ones were isolated rather than actively participating in organized events.

Safety is another focal point within the discussions surrounding Terra Pointe Memory Care. Many responses indicate that while there are moments when safety measures seem prioritized – such as room conditions being satisfactory with no unpleasant odors – there remain worries about staffing adequacy during weekends and holidays. Anecdotes describe locked bathrooms during staff meetings or neglect during busy times when more attention might be warranted—leading families to question whether adequate supervision exists throughout every hour of operation.

Finally, experiences with environmental factors like accessibility have emerged within these reviews too; some family members expressed frustration regarding visitation policies that restrict spontaneous visits due perceived safety measures related to COVID-19 regulations or other reasons typical among healthcare settings today. Despite this restriction impacting how often they could see their loved ones in person outside scheduled appointments—many recipients of care emphasized enjoying spacious accommodations enhancing overall residential comfort levels.

In summary, while Terra Pointe Memory Care provides various standout qualities appreciated by numerous families—such as commendable culinary offerings alongside genuine rapport-building efforts made on behalf of employees—the conflicting sentiments concerning caregiver treatment capabilities alongside visitation limitations suggest complexities warranting deeper reflection before choosing them as suitable long-term placements amidst growing demands surrounding cognitive impairments.
